In Chapter 4, Global Communications and Diversity, Peter Cardon identifies eight cultural dimensions. Individualism and Collecti

vism Egalitarianism and Hierarchy Performance Orientation Future Orientation Assertiveness Humane Orientation Uncertainty Avoidance Gender Egalitarianism In the chapter, nations from around the world are assigned scores and rankings based on each of these dimensions. For your initial post, discuss the scores and rankings of a country other than the United States on at least two of the cultural dimensions. Which rankings were close to what you had expected, and which ones were surprises? Do you feel that these rankings on cultural dimensions provide useful information, or do they perpetuate cultural stereotypes?
